    Unexpected events can occur that may leave you with cancelled plans, lost luggage or medical expenses that you weren’t planning for. The various plans developed for brol.com by Travel Guard are affordable and they offer a broad package of benefits that provides coverage for such unexpected events.

    To demonstrate the importance of purchasing travel insurance, here are some common examples of what could go wrong.

    1. It's 10 p.m. and you have arrived at the airport for a connecting flight to Rio, only to find that it has been cancelled. Who can assist you with finding new flights to catch up with your trip?
    2. Your bag was lost with your prescription drug inside. You need help to locate your bag as soon as possible and have your emergency prescription filled. Who do you call?
    3. Well arrived at your destination, your passport and wallet are stolen. Where do you turn for emergency cash, and how will you get your passport replaced?
    4. Your sister-in-law becomes seriously ill and you must cancel your trip. What happens to your non-refundable deposits or pre-payments?
    5. You arrive in Brazil and your luggage doesn't. If it's lost, who will help you find it? If it's delayed, who will pay for your necessities? If it's stolen, who will pay to replace it?
    6. You're touring the Amazon and twist your ankle. Who can help you find a physician to have it examined?
